Comprehending the Renault Megane Cardkey Technology
Unlike traditional metal secrets that rely purely on mechanical cuts, Renault cardkeys are sophisticated electronic devices. Over the various generations of the Megane-- from the Megane II introduced in the early 2000s as much as the contemporary Megane IV and E-Tech designs-- the innovation has actually evolved substantially.
Early variations relied on infrared and fundamental radio frequency (RF) signals, paired with a transponder chip that interacted with the car's immobilizer. Modern versions feature sophisticated distance picking up (hands-free entry), integrated emergency metal blades, and encrypted rolling codes that prevent relay-station theft.
Due to the fact that of this complex programming, you can not simply go to a regional hardware shop and have a copy made on a standard cutting maker. Every replacement card must be securely matched with the lorry's onboard computer.
Common Issues with Megane Cardkeys
Before hurrying into a complete replacement, it assists to comprehend why a cardkey may fail. Often, the concern is small and doesn't require purchasing a completely brand-new system.
- Dead or Weak Battery: The most common culprit. A failing battery can avoid the distance sensor from working, even if the manual buttons still function.
- Internal Circuit Board Damage: Because drivers often rest on their wallets including the cardkey, the internal solder joints can crack under pressure.
- Desynchronization: Occasionally, the card loses its digital "handshake" with the car due to severe battery drain or signal disturbance.
- Physical Wear and Tear: Cracked external plastic housings can expose the fragile electronic devices to moisture and dust.

If you choose to go through an automobile locksmith professional or a dealer, the replacement procedure generally follows a structured procedure to make sure car security.
1. Verification of Ownership
To prevent auto theft, trusted locksmith professionals and car dealerships will lawfully need evidence that you own the car. You will normally require to supply:
- A government-issued picture ID matching the registration.
- The vehicle registration file (V5C or regional equivalent).
- The Vehicle Identification Number (VIN), normally found on the dashboard or inside the chauffeur's door jamb.
2. Key Cutting
Even though it is a "card," most Renault Master Key Replacement smart cards feature a concealed metal emergency blade. This mechanical key is cut initially so that you can by hand open the car doors if the electronic system ever stops working entirely.
3. Electronic Programming
This is the most critical action. The technician will plug a diagnostic computer into the Megane's OBD-II port (located underneath the control panel). Utilizing specific software, they will:
- Extract the vehicle's security PIN code.
- Program the new transponder chip inside the card to match the car's immobilizer system.
- (Optional) Erase the memory of any lost or stolen cards so they can no longer begin the vehicle.
Tips to Prevent Future Cardkey Headaches
Changing a contemporary wise key is seldom inexpensive. Executing a few preventative practices can save Renault owners substantial hassle and expense down the road:
- Avoid Sitting on the Card: Make it a habit to take your cardkey out of your back pocket before driving or taking a seat. Flexing the card snaps tiny traces on the internal circuit board.
- Keep It Dry: While contemporary cards are relatively durable, prolonged exposure to moisture, cleaning makers, or swimming pools will fry the internal electronic devices.
- Buy a Protective Silicone Case: Inexpensive rubber or silicone sleeves take in shock if the card is dropped on difficult pavement and help hold split plastic real estates together.
- Constantly Have a Spare: Never wait up until you lose your only key to get a replacement. Programming a second card while you still have a working original is typically faster and less pricey than beginning from scratch with no working secrets.
